2014-10-30 3 views
0

를 사용하여 기존 파일에 내용을 추가 할 수 있지만 어쨌든 물어 볼게요 :CURL는 -, 나는 그것이 불가능하다고 생각 구글에 컬에 대한 정보를 검색 한 후 하나 개의 요청

인가 파일 사용하여 컬에 내용을 추가 할 수 있습니다 원본 콘텐츠를 변경하지 않고 (하나의 말림 요청 만 사용)!

는 예를 들어, 나는 간단한 txt 파일이 있습니다 "안녕하세요이 테스트는"

을 나는 파일에 다른 줄을 추가 할 것입니다 : "안녕하세요이 테스트 내가 두 번째 라인을 가지고 ! "

curl THE_FTP_ADRESS -X PUT -1 -v --disable-epsv --ftp-skip-pasv-ip --ftp-ssl-ccc -u MYUSR:PASS --upload-file MY_FILE_ADRESS 

내가 그 다음, ftp 서버에서 파일을 가져올 내가 추가하고 그것을 덮어 쓰기 할 부분을 추가 할 수 있다고 생각 :

, 현재 나의 컬은 (내 파일을 덮어)과 같다 ftp 서버가 필요하지만이 작업을 수행하는 더 간단한 방법이 있는지 알고 싶습니다.

답변

2

Nop는 ...

이것은 FTP 클래스 옵션 :

-a, --append가 : 업로드에 사용하는 경우 (FTP를/SFTP),이 컬 APPEND 대상 파일 대신 덮어 쓰기의 수 . 원격 파일이 존재하지 않으면 생성됩니다. 이 플래그는 일부 SFTP 서버 (OpenSSH 포함)에서 무시됩니다.

관련 문제